RECIPE – Honey cakes

INGREDIENTS

250 g honey
250 (g) sugar
2 eggs (Vegan-see below)
1 tablespoons cinnamon
2 TSP bumped cloves
1 TSP Cardamom
Torn shell of a lemon
25 g pommeranskal (available in eco (It is candied orange) the rest can be frozen until next year)
200 (g) chopped peeled almonds (chopped with knife, not fine as powder)
12 g potash dissolved in water
1/4 TSP antler salt
CA. 1/2 kg flour

VEGAN: I have baked a portion without eggs, they need to bake a bit longer, and may be a bit harder in the, but still tastes great 🙂 Alternatively I would mix 2 TSP fiber remember with 4 tablespoons water as a substitute for 2 eggs,

APPROACH

  • Honey and sugar is melted (heats) together and allow to cool a little
  • Then stir potasken in (is mixed in water first)
  • The spices are met in
  • Eggs, almonds and flour mixed in
  • The dough is kneaded
  • Roll the dough into balls (CA 6 cm in diameter) and gi’ them on the forehead (quote my grandmother)
  • Bake 6-8 my 200 ° c
  • The trick now is to not bake them too long, for so they can be quite hard when they are cooled
  • Low possibly test to break a, as soon as there is no raw dough in the Middle take the out
  • Cool
  • Pipe a thick glaze with powdered sugar and water and put a dollop on each
  • If they are stacked in a cake tin so wait until the glaze is completely dry
